This article mainly introduces the configuration, deployment and use of pipeline (>=1.1.0 version support) engine.
Note: before compiling the pipelineengine, you need to compile the linkis project in full Currently, the pipeline engine needs to be installed and deployed by itself
This engine plug-in is not included in the published installation and deployment package by default, You can follow this guide to deploy the installation https://linkis.apache.org/blog/2022/04/15/how-to-download-engineconn-plugin Or manually compile the deployment according to the following process
Compile separatelypipeline
${linkis_code_dir}/linkis-enginepconn-pugins/engineconn-plugins/pipeline/
mvn clean install
The engine package compiled in step 1.1 is located in
${linkis_code_dir}/linkis-engineconn-plugins/engineconn-plugins/pipeline/target/out/pipeline
Upload to the engine directory of the server
${LINKIS_HOME}/lib/linkis-engineplugins
And restart the linkis engineplugin to refresh the engine
cd ${LINKIS_HOME}/sbin sh linkis-daemon.sh restart linkis-cg-linkismanager
Or refresh through the engine interface. After the engine is placed in the corresponding directory, send a refresh request to the linkis CG engineconplugin service through the HTTP interface.
Interfacehttp://${engineconn-plugin-server-IP}:${port}/api/rest_j/v1/rpc/receiveAndReply
Request mode POST
{ "method": "/enginePlugin/engineConn/refreshAll" }
Check whether the engine is refreshed successfully: if you encounter problems during the refresh process and need to confirm whether the refresh is successful, you can view thelinkis_engine_conn_plugin_bml_resourcesOf this tablelast_update_timeWhether it is the time when the refresh is triggered.
#Log in to the database of linkis select * from linkis_cg_engine_conn_plugin_bml_resources

Link 1.0 provides cli to submit tasks. We only need to specify the corresponding enginecon and codetype tag types. The use of pipeline is as follows:
sh bin/linkis-cli -submitUser hadoop -engineType pipeline-1 -codeType pipeline -code "from hdfs:///000/000/000/A.dolphin to file:///000/000/000/B.csv"
from hdfs:///000/000/000/A.dolphin to file:///000/000/000/B.csv 3.3 Explained
For specific use, please refer to: Linkis CLI Manual.
becausepipelineThe engine is mainly used to import and export files. Now let's assume that importing files from a to B is the most introduced case
Right click the workspace module and select Create a new workspace of typestorageScript for
The syntax is file copy rule:dolphinSuffix type files are result set files that can be converted to.csvType and.xlsxType file, other types can only be copied from address a to address B, referred to as handling
#dolphin type from hdfs:///000/000/000/A.dolphin to file:///000/000/000/B.csv from hdfs:///000/000/000/A.dolphin to file:///000/000/000/B.xlsx #Other types from hdfs:///000/000/000/A.txt to file:///000/000/000/B.txt
A file importing script to B folder
from hdfs:///000/000/000/A.csv to file:///000/000/B/
from grammar,to:grammarhdfs:///000/000/000/A.csv:Input file pathfile:///000/000/B/: Output pathfile B is exported as file A
from hdfs:///000/000/000/B.csv to file:///000/000/000/A.CSV
hdfs:///000/000/000/B.csv: Input file pathfile:///000/000/000/A.CSV: Output file pathNote: no semicolon is allowed at the end of the syntax; Otherwise, the syntax is incorrect.
